#12 Sunday Sounds - My Favourite Spring Scents

When it comes to Spring I like to wear quite fresh and floral perfumes so I thought I would pick out my current favourites for you.

Top of the list is the Jo Malone Peony & Blush Suede Cologne, this is so light and pretty and is just perfect for a Spring day. When first spritzed it is quite sharp and crisp smelling but once it has settled down a slight musky scent starts to come through which just brings it back down. It is absolutely lovely and great for this time of year when you want something that feels light and subtle but still gives a lovely fresh scent. It lasts all day so there's no need to top up throughout the day which I feel very glad about as the bottle is quite big and bulky and is actually quite heavy when in your handbag. I might invest in a smaller travel friendly bottle of this perfume as it is my favourite and it would be really handy to have.

Next is the D&G 3 L'Imperatrice. This is a really sweet smelling perfume, quite a few of my family and friends can't stand this perfume as they find it a little too sickly sweet but I love it. It has a real signature scent to it and I can always smell it if someone wafts past me wearing it. The bottle is similar to Jo Malone in that it is quite heavy and bulky so not great for chucking in your handbag but it tends to last me all day so there's no need to carry it round.

The Hugo Boss Ma Vie Pour Femme is a lovely scent, very fresh and floral with cactus flower, pink freesia, jasmine and delicate rose buds so perfect for the Spring and Summer months. The bottle isn't tiny but not too big if you wanted to throw in your handbag quick. 

And lastly, Marc Jacobs Daisy Eau So Fresh. This is just a newer version of the original daisy. It is a lovely floral scent but not floral as in smells of just freshly cut roses, it has many different ingredients giving the perfume a real depth. The thing I love most about this perfume is the pretty bottle! I love the little flowers on top, it makes it uber pretty on your dressing table and even the colours on the bottle just remind me of Spring.
